    Goals / Remit

    The European American Chamber of Commerce® provides its members with access to transatlantic business opportunities as well as timely and relevant information, resources and support on matters affecting business activities between Europe and the U.S.

    We are NOT a lobbying group. We connect business executives and help them better understand transatlantic business relations and build a network of peers.

    The goal of the EACC’s New York Chapter is to stimulate business development, and to facilitate networking and relationships between European and American businesses & professional organizations.

    EACC is a transatlantic network where Europeans & Americans Connect to do Business.

    Communication activities

    EACC NY hosts educational seminars, panel discussions and roundtables to educate its members and the wider Tris-state business community on matters relevant to doing business on both sides of the Atlantic.

    Topics include: transatlantic relations, trade, regulatory and legal issues, financial services/markets, taxation, technology & innovation, Private Equity, Mergers & Acquisitions, Privacy & GDPR, economic matters on both sides of the Atlantic, investment promotions/FDI, Trade agreements, Energy/Infrastructure, Brexit and others.

    We also host regular newsmakers with EU representatives see for additional information: https://www.eaccny.com/events/past-event-highlights

    Other activities

    EACC New York is involved in the United Nations Business Sector Steering Committee for Financing for Development.
